Understanding Latitude and Longitude: A Geographical Primer
Before we pinpoint Sydney's exact location, let's refresh our understanding of latitude and longitude. These two coordinates form the foundation of the global grid system used to locate any point on Earth's surface.
-
Latitude: Latitude measures the distance north or south of the Earth's equator, an imaginary line circling the globe at 0 degrees. Lines of latitude are called parallels because they run parallel to the equator. They range from 0° at the equator to 90° North at the North Pole and 90° South at the South Pole. Higher latitude signifies a location closer to the poles, resulting in colder temperatures and shorter days during certain seasons.
-
Longitude: Longitude measures the distance east or west of the Prime Meridian, an imaginary line running from the North Pole to the South Pole through Greenwich, England. Lines of longitude are called meridians and converge at the poles. They range from 0° at the Prime Meridian to 180° East and 180° West. The 180° meridian marks the International Date Line, where the date changes.
Together, latitude and longitude create a unique coordinate pair for every location on Earth, allowing for precise mapping and navigation.
Pinpointing Sydney: Its Latitude and Longitude
Sydney's geographic coordinates are approximately 33.8688° South latitude and 151.2093° East longitude. This specific coordinate pair places Sydney in the Southern Hemisphere and the Eastern Hemisphere. It's crucial to understand that this is an approximation; different sources might offer slightly varying figures due to differing methods of measurement and the complexities of defining a city's center. However, the values provided offer an accurate representation for most practical purposes.
The Significance of Sydney's Coordinates: Climate and More
Sydney's latitude significantly impacts its climate. Located at approximately 34° South, it falls within a temperate climate zone. This means Sydney experiences four distinct seasons, although the summers are generally warm and the winters are mild compared to higher-latitude cities. The influence of the Pacific Ocean also moderates temperatures, preventing extreme heat or cold.
However, Sydney's position is not uniformly temperate. Different parts of the city, particularly those closer to the coast versus those inland, will experience microclimates. These variations occur due to factors like proximity to the sea, altitude, and local topography. The latitude contributes to the overall climate pattern, but other geographic features refine the specific weather conditions in different parts of Sydney.
Beyond climate, Sydney's longitude also influences its time zone. Located at approximately 151° East, it falls within the Australian Eastern Standard Time (AEST) zone, which is 10 hours ahead of Coordinated Universal Time (UTC). This time zone difference has significant implications for international communication and trade.

Practical Applications of Sydney's Coordinates
Beyond understanding the broader climatic and biological impacts, Sydney's latitude and longitude have several practical applications:
-
Navigation: These coordinates are essential for GPS systems, enabling accurate navigation within the city and its surrounding areas. Whether you're using a car's navigation system, a smartphone app, or even a traditional map, the latitude and longitude form the basis of location identification.
-
Mapping: Accurate mapping of Sydney relies heavily on these coordinates. Cartographers use this information to create detailed maps that show the city's streets, landmarks, and other features. This precision is crucial for urban planning, emergency services, and various other purposes.
-
Geographic Information Systems (GIS): GIS technology uses latitude and longitude data to analyze spatial relationships, manage geographical data, and create visualizations of geographic phenomena. This is vital for urban planning, environmental monitoring, and resource management in Sydney.
-
Astronomy: While less directly relevant to everyday life, Sydney's latitude plays a role in astronomical observations. The city's Southern Hemisphere location offers unique views of the night sky, including constellations and celestial objects not visible in the Northern Hemisphere.
Frequently Asked Questions (FAQ)
Q: Are Sydney's coordinates fixed?
A: While the coordinates are generally considered stable, they can be subject to slight variations depending on the reference system and measurement techniques used. These variations are typically very small and insignificant for most practical applications. The Earth's crust is also in constant, albeit minute, motion, which technically affects coordinates over vast periods.
Q: How accurate are the coordinates usually presented?
A: The accuracy depends on the source and the purpose of the measurement. For general purposes, the precision to several decimal places (as shown earlier) is usually sufficient. However, highly specialized applications, such as surveying or satellite navigation, may require much greater precision.
Q: Can I use Sydney's coordinates to find a specific location within the city?
A: The coordinates provided represent the approximate center of Sydney. They won't pinpoint a specific street address or building. To locate specific points within Sydney, you'd need more detailed address information or a more precise coordinate system with higher resolution.
